## PR: Sticky bucketing for Splitgate assignment service

This change fixes the drift we discussed at last week's sync, where users on the Harrowell mobile client could flip experiment arms after a cache eviction. Assignment is now derived from a salted hash of the stable subject key, with a short-lived cache kept purely as an optimization. Re-randomization only happens on explicit experiment version bumps. Rollout is behind a flag, dark-launched to the Veldan staging cluster first. The hashing and cache tuning constants are listed below.

tuning table, kajog-bawip:
TIERS = {
    "kelius": 256,
    "lammir": 543,
}

Ticket: Vault locked on Renderpile transcode farm.

Secrets vault sealed itself after three failed unseal attempts during last night's node rotation. Encode workers can't fetch codec licenses; queue is paused. Maintainers: don't cycle the vault pods — that resets the attempt counter the wrong way. Unseal manually from the primary node using the recovery passphrase:

unlock words, hahip-baduf: holwyn-istath-julvan

Ticket: Missed pick-up, loaned exhibition pieces. The scheduled Tuesday collection of three ceramic works on loan from the Fennick Gallery to the Orlace Museum did not occur; the courier arrived after the loading dock at Harrow Court had closed. Pieces remain crated in secure storage, seals intact, condition reports unchanged. A replacement collection is booked for Thursday morning, and the registrar will be present to witness crating checks. The confidential instruction for the courier hand-over follows directly below.

handover note for yagef-bagep: the drudor pelius courier leaves the kasdor zorvan norir ledger at gate 8016 under passcode 755406

Subject: DR drill outcome — tenant quotas

Hi,

For your review: during yesterday's Bramblehook disaster-recovery drill, per-tenant rate quotas carried over correctly to the standby region, with no tenant exceeding its ceiling during replay. Quota counters reset cleanly at cutback. Full evidence is in the drill folder; to open the sealed drill archive, enter the passphrase below.

vault phrase of kawep-tahog = ulaix-briath